What you’ll need

Gather these items for your delightful cookie batch:

  • 1 cup mashed sweet potato (about 1 medium, cooked & mashed)
  • 1 ½ cups rolled oats
  • ½ cup almond flour (or regular flour)
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• ¼ tsp nutmeg
  • ¼ tsp baking soda
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• ⅓ cup maple syrup or honey
  • 1 egg
  • 2 tbsp melted coconut oil or butter
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• ⅓ cup chopped pecans or walnuts (optional)
  • ⅓ cup raisins or dried cranberries (optional)

You can easily swap out the sweetener or nuts based on your dietary preferences to make this recipe your own!

Step-by-step instructions

Cinnamon Sweet Potato Breakfast Cookies

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the mashed sweet potato, egg, maple syrup, melted coconut oil or butter, and vanilla extract. Mix until smooth.
  3. Stir in the rolled oats, almond fl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, baking soda, and salt until just combined.
  4. Gently fold in the optional chopped nuts and dried fruit if you’re using them.
  5. Scoop about 2 tablespoons of dough for each cookie onto the prepared baking sheet, slightly flattening each scoop.
  6. Bake for 12–15 minutes or until the cookies are set and golden on the bottom.
  7. Allow the cookies to cool completely on a wire rack; they will firm up nicely as they cool down.

Storage and reheating tips

To keep your c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. For longer storage, you can freeze them in a freezer-safe bag; just make sure to separate the cookies with parchment paper to prevent sticking. Reheat in the microwave for a few seconds before enjoying—this will make them just as delicious as the day they were baked!

Helpful cooking tips

  • Make sure your sweet potatoes are well-cooked and smooth; this will create a better texture for your cookies.
  • Experiment with different spices! Try adding a pinch of ginger or allspice for a fun twist.
  • Want to make them gluten-free? Opt for certified gluten-free oats and ensure your almond flour is also gluten-free.

Common questions

How long does it take to prepare these cookies?
Preparation takes about 15 minutes, and baking takes around 12–15 minutes, making these cookies a quick culinary project.

Can I use canned sweet potato?
Yes, canned sweet potato works in a pinch! Just ensure it’s pureed without added sugar or spices.

What’s the best way to store leftovers?
Keep them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week, or freeze for longer storage.

Are there any vegan options for this recipe?
Absolutely! You can substitute the egg with a flax egg (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 3 tablespoons water) for a vegan-friendly option.
